Twenty years earlier, the supplier was in control of the B2B sales process.
If you helped a significant company like Cisco or Dell and were turning out a new networking item, all you had to do was take a look at your sales channel as well as begin making phone calls. Obtaining the visit with a significant B2B client was relatively easy.
Clients understood they likely required what you were marketing, and were more than delighted to have you be available in as well as answer their concerns.
Today, contacts from those same companies won't also address the telephone call. They've currently checked the market, and you will not hear back until they prepare to make a step.
The sales channel used to function since we understood where to locate clients that were at a particular stage in the acquiring process. For marketers, that suggested utilizing the right method to reach customers at the right time.
What you do not recognize can assist you.
I belong to an advertising team called Top Area. The membership is mostly chief advertising police officers and also various other marketing leaders that are all making every effort to end up being 1% far better everyday. It's a world-class group of expert marketers.
There are everyday discussions within Optimal Community regarding the devices of the profession. Participants would like to know what CRMs their peers are making use of, and people in the group are more than delighted to share that details.
Yet none of the brand names have a clue that they are being talked about as well as suggested. Yet these discussions are affecting the acquiring actions of team participants. If I sing the applauds of a marketing automation system to a person who's about to purchase another service, I just know they're going to obtain a demonstration of the option I informed them regarding before they make their purchasing decision.
These untrackable, unattributable dark social interactions between peers and also customers are driving buying decisions in the B2B room.
Come to be a critical neighborhood contractor.
In 2022, building community requires to be a component of your B2B advertising plan, and developing material regularly is an indispensable means to engage community participants weekly.
While dark social communications can't be tracked, marketers can develop the neighborhoods (such as a LinkedIn group) that cultivate these conversations. A community's excitement for your material increases its effect. By focusing on your area members' degree of interaction, you can increase the neighborhood's overall reach as well as in turn your influence in the community.
And also content production needs to be the focal point. This strategy isn't mosting likely to work overnight, which can be irritating if you're impatient. However acting upon that impatience will certainly lead to failure.
Constructing an important area does require the appropriate investment of time as well as sources. Once somewhat developed, you can see every one of the interactions that would otherwise be unseen.
You can even take it a step additionally. Possibly you notice that a number of your team's participants are gathered in a geographical area. By organizing a meetup because location for neighborhood participants, you allow them to deepen their ties to the neighborhood you have actually developed.
By raising the depth of the connection with that neighborhood you've produced, you're likewise boosting the area's reach. The core target market comes to be extra involved-- they're sharing your web content on LinkedIn and also Twitter-- and the following point you recognize, you're obtaining marked in conversations by individuals you have actually never become aware of previously.
Yes, your business's internet site is crucial.
I can recall conversations with coworkers from just 3 years ago about the value of the firm website. Those discussions would certainly always go back and forth on just how much (or exactly click here how little) effort we should be taking into the maintenance of the website.
Since we understand about the power of dark social, the answer of just how much to purchase your internet site must be noticeable. Nevertheless, where is the first place someone is mosting likely to go after becoming aware of your company throughout a meeting, or after checking out an item of content about you on LinkedIn? Where are they mosting likely to most likely to learn more regarding among your firm's founders or executives?
You don't recognize what you do not know, as well as it's nearly difficult to know how every prospect is discovering your organization.
But one thing is specific: When individuals need to know more about you, the first place they're likely to look is your site.
Think about your web site as your store front. If the store front remains in disrepair and also just fifty percent of the open indicator is brightened, individuals are mosting likely to maintain relocating.
Profits: Continual financial investment in your internet site is a must.
